Output 57a8d89c47a842a2c3fe8d1529fb70ee68705662d1afe87b0d95cc3c198daf45:1

value
970258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8803fc273d3a4204f48398ae2111d063eef5c3e2 OP_EQUAL
address
3E6CbWjjgBxEQxN1mtk65SxBWrmR62Vfe5
transaction
57a8d89c47a842a2c3fe8d1529fb70ee68705662d1afe87b0d95cc3c198daf45
spent
true